Bride's Reddit Post Highlights Growing Trend of Wedding Guests Skipping Gifts
A bride's frustration over giftless guests reflects changing attitudes toward wedding gift-giving, with financial factors playing a significant role.
- A bride expressed dismay on Reddit after 70% of her wedding guests failed to give gifts or cards.
- Many commenters supported the bride, asserting it is customary to bring gifts to weddings.
- Survey data reveals a trend, with 72% of Gen Z comfortable attending weddings without gifts.
- Experts point to financial constraints as a reason for this shift in traditional wedding etiquette.
- Some suggest that the high cost of weddings and related events is creating gift-giving fatigue.
